Understanding Detoxification

Detoxifying your body is essential for optimal health and wellness. However, it’s not as simple as going on a juice cleanse for a few days or taking a magic pill. Detoxification is a complex process that involves removing harmful toxins from your body and supporting your organs’ natural detoxification pathways.

What Are Toxins?

Toxins are harmful substances that can negatively impact your health. They can come from the food you eat, the air you breathe, the products you use, and the environment around you. Some common toxins include heavy metals, pesticides, synthetic chemicals, and pollutants.

How Does Detoxification Work?

Detoxification is a natural process that your body goes through every day. Your liver, kidneys, lungs, and skin work together to eliminate toxins from your body. However, when your body is overloaded with toxins, it can’t keep up, and toxins can accumulate in your body.

Type and Amount of Toxins

The type and amount of toxins in your body will affect the time it takes to detoxify. For example, if you have a high level of heavy metals in your body, it may take longer to detoxify than if you have a low level of toxins.

Your Body’s Detoxification Capacity

Everyone’s body is different, and some people have a more efficient detoxification system than others. If your body’s detoxification pathways are compromised, it may take longer to detoxify your body.

Your Diet and Lifestyle Habits

Your diet and lifestyle habits can either support or hinder your body’s natural detoxification process. Eating a healthy diet, staying hydrated, getting enough sleep, and exercising regularly can all help support your body’s natural detoxification process.

Different Types of Detoxification

There are several different types of detoxification programs and methods, and each one can vary in duration.

Short-Term Detox Programs

Short-term detox programs typically last anywhere from 1-7 days. These programs are designed to give your body a break from toxins and support your body’s natural detoxification process. Juice cleanses, fasting, and elimination diets are all examples of short-term detox programs.

Long-Term Detox Programs

Long-term detox programs are designed to help your body eliminate toxins over a more extended period, typically 21-30 days. These programs typically involve dietary and lifestyle changes to support your body’s natural detoxification process.
